About me
Born in the UK in 1967, I currently live and work in North Yorkshire. Prior to becoming a photographer I worked for over ten years in international ethical and rural development. In 2007 I was awarded the title of Fujifilm Student Photographer of the Year and was nominated for the New York Photo Awards in 2008. My work has been exhibited both in the UK and internationally. Alongside my role as a documentary photographer I undertake photographic commissions, lectures and research projects in the non-governmental and commercial sectors. My current work continues to explore issues around conflict, beauty and renewal.
